These are the questions asked by a reader of the ‘Basta!’ Telegram channel from Minsk:

- The news from Yarmoshyna’s circus surprised no one. Today, they spat in the faces of not only 400 thousand belarusians, who put their signatures for Viktar Babaryka. They spat in the faces of all of us - all those who wanted fair elections.

Even when isolated, thrown to jail, Viktar Babaryka, who cannot possibly be holding a full-fledged electoral campaign from behind the bars, turned to be so dangerous for ‘Alex the 3%’, that this cowardly 3% oldman refused him the right to be a presidential candidate. First, they did this trick with the arrest of Siarhei Tsikhanouski in order to prevent him from nominating. Now the Borsch-Cooker took on the function of a prosecutor in a courtroom, having read from paper the bullshit no one believes in.

Now it’s only up to us whether we keep tolerating this, remain silent, or we will finally start struggling for our leaders; whether we pretend nothing happened, or demand fair elections and registration of the most popular presidential candidate.
